Petition Filed in Parliament Seeking Merger of Kenya’s Pension Schemes and Fairer Benefits for Retirees

A group of retired civil servants has formally petitioned Parliament to overhaul Kenya’s pension system, calling for the consolidation of existing schemes, higher monthly payouts, and stronger protection against inflation.

The petition, presented to the National Assembly by Speaker Moses Wetang’ula on behalf of the Kenya National Association of Public Service Pensioners (KNAPSP), argues that the current fragmented structure is inequitable. Many retirees, the petitioners say, are struggling to meet rising living costs and face unequal treatment compared to newer public servants who benefit from a modern contributory framework.

Specifically, the retirees want all non-contributory civil service pension schemes merged into a single system to improve fairness, efficiency, and management of retirement benefits. They also ask the National Treasury, in collaboration with the Salaries and Remuneration Commission (SRC), to carry out an actuarial study on pension payments and recommend inflation-linked adjustments.

Speaking in Parliament, Speaker Wetang’ula summarized the petitioners’ concerns: “They argue that while new entrants benefit from the modern contributory framework, existing retirees remain tethered to an obsolete system characterised by inadequate and irregular payments.”

The petition is led by John Serem, Eng Richard Bett, and Olive Chepkoech. They point specifically to the Public Service Superannuation Scheme Act of 2012, which shifted from a non-contributory to a contributory system effective January 1, 2021. According to the petitioners, this created a “dual pension system” where older retirees are left with low and irregular payments while newer workers enjoy better terms. They describe this as discrimination against those who served the same government.

Additional concerns raised in the petition include:

Difficulties faced by dependents in accessing benefits after a pensioner’s death, due to lengthy bureaucratic procedures.

Partial implementation of the SRC’s 2014 recommendation that pensions be reviewed every three years.

The requirement that retiring officers commute a quarter of their pension into a lump-sum payment, which reduces their monthly income.

Several MPs who debated the petition voiced support. Emuhaya MP Omboko Milemba acknowledged the problems of inflation, delayed payments, and challenges for dependents, noting that the Pensions Department’s budget consumption was only about 39 percent, yet many teachers and civil servants remain unpaid. However, he cautioned that merging the old scheme with the Public Service Superannuation Fund is complex due to age-related timelines for joining the contributory scheme.

Githunguri MP Gathoni Wamuchomba called pension matters a national priority and backed proposals to exempt pensioners from income tax. “We are considering how we are going to make sure that pensioners are no longer going to pay income tax on their income,” she told the House. “It is in the interest of this House to make sure that all pensioners are treated fairly and whatever they are paid is their money without further deductions.”

The petition has now been referred to the Petitions Committee for further consideration.
